Abstract
We discuss the H\'{e}non parabolic equation in a finite ball in under the Dirichlet boundary condition, where , , and . We assume that the exponent is supercritical in the Sobolev sense. Since the spatial potential term vanishes at the origin, solutions seem less likely to blow up at the origin. We construct a solution that blows up at the origin and also carry out an analysis of blow-up rate of solutions. In particular, if is less than the Joseph--Lundgren exponent, all blow-ups are shown to be of Type I. The lower bound corresponding to Type I rate is also shown for some particular blow-up solutions. As by products, we present a basic result on classification to threshold solutions for every .
